PSL8: Quetta Gladiators face Peshawar Zalmi with eye on playoffs

To proceed in the current Pakistan Premier League (PSL) season 8 against star-studded Peshawar Zalmi, the struggling Quetta Gladiators must defeat the team. Sarafaraz-led Gladiators presently have four points and a net run rate of -1.344, which puts them at the bottom of the points standings.

Eyes on Playoffs of PSL8

Sarfaraz Ahmed, the captain of Purple Force, is not expected to play today’s game due to an injury to his left ring finger while the team is struggling. After being brought to the hospital after the game, scans on the captain indicated no serious injury concern.

The management of the team will keep an eye on the situation, and an evaluation will be done before making a final decision. In the Pindi Cricket Stadium earlier, Quetta Gladiators defeated Karachi Kings by four wickets in an effort to advance to the Twenty20 league playoffs.

Also Read: Islamabad United Qualified for the playoffs of PSL Season 8

Quetta Gladiators will need to overcome Peshawar Zalmi in order to advance to the playoff round, while they also need to win both of their games against the Sultans and Zalmi. On the other side, Peshawar Zalmi, who has a net run rate of -0.509, is positioned at the fourth slot points table. Yellow Storm crushed Lahore Qalandars on Tuesday, and they must keep up their winning ways to proceed in the PSL.
